2 out of 5 stars PSP Technical Review - A Real Dissapointment   September 22, 2005
 13 out of 14 found this review helpful

After 10 years, 'Pulp Fiction' still holds up as an absolute classic, and thankfully Beuna Vista/Miramax have released this gem on PSP for all us to enjoy.

How does it rate.....well, not so good I'm afraid.

Picture:
Like Kill Bill Vol 1+2, the picture is nice and sharp, and in it's Original Aspect ratio of 2:35. The black levels are a little mirky and lack that blackness of say Sin City, but still holds up well. A little desaturated on UMD, but i guess, so was the original film.

Score: 3/5

Audio:
This is where it falls to pieces. Basically, it stinks. A terrible audio presentation that begins and ends on the lowest volume I've experienced on any UMD. Even with the UMD volume set to +2 and on maximum, it's no-where near what it should be. It's trouble with the mastering. It's lacking on both the high ends and low ends. Lacking sharpness in the gushots that usually scare the hell out of me at the start, to the bass and richness of the infamous soundtrack...it lacks all.

Score: 1/5

Extras:
None, zilch, even the terrible menus were ripped straight from the DVD.

Score: 1/5

Overall:
One of my fav films, and one i was looking forward to all month, is below scratch. Not to say that it's unwatchable, just don't expect anything near great. Very bad Beuna Vista, very bad indeed.

Score: 2/5
